35.8% of the people in Austin (zip 16720) are religious:
- 1.7% are Baptist
- 0.8% are Episcopalian
- 10.7% are Catholic
- 3.0% are Lutheran
- 6.6% are Methodist
- 0.3% are Pentecostal
- 1.0% are Presbyterian
- 0.0% are Church of Jesus Christ
- 11.7% are another Christian faith
- 0.0% are Judaism
- 0.0% are an eastern faith
- 0.0% affilitates with Islam
